Will they slow me down?

Going from 16" aluminum rims to 18" chrome rims. I know they will probably be heavier but despite the weight will the size matter?

Well, as you pointed out, they'll probably be heavier, which will rob some power. How much?
Also, if you're keeping the same overall diameter, then you're going to have a lot less sidewall on the tire, and may lose some launch traction since you'll have less sidewall flex.
